In the ever-evolving landscape of customer communication, businesses need to ensure they are meeting their customers where they are. Channel Preferences Support in BPO refers to the services provided by Business Process Outsourcing (BPO) companies that help businesses track, manage, and update customers’ communication preferences across various channels. These preferences may include email, phone, social media, live chat, and more. By understanding and catering to customers’ preferred communication channels, businesses can enhance customer satisfaction, streamline interactions, and improve overall service delivery.
In this article, we will delve into the significance of Channel Preferences Support in BPO, explore the different types of communication channels that businesses manage, and explain how maintaining accurate channel preferences can benefit both the business and the customer.
Channel Preferences Support in BPO is the process of managing customer preferences related to how they want to be contacted or engaged across various communication channels. It is an essential aspect of customer experience management, allowing businesses to offer personalized, efficient, and convenient interactions with their customers. BPOs play a crucial role in collecting, updating, and storing customer preferences, ensuring that businesses only contact customers through their preferred channels.
The goal of Channel Preferences Support in BPO is to improve communication efficiency, reduce customer frustration, and increase engagement by aligning communication strategies with customer desires. This service can include preference management across various touchpoints like voice calls, emails, mobile apps, social media platforms, and more.
BPO providers manage multiple types of channel preferences to ensure businesses are offering seamless communication experiences. Below are the main types of channel preferences supported in BPO:
Many customers still prefer communicating via traditional voice channels such as phone calls. Voice channel preferences refer to the customer’s preference for being contacted or supported through voice-based communication. BPO providers manage these preferences to ensure customers receive timely and personalized support via phone calls.
In the digital age, email remains a popular communication channel for customers. Email preferences involve the customer’s preferred frequency of receiving emails, specific types of email content (such as promotional offers, product updates, or support-related emails), and the choice to receive personalized messages. BPOs help manage and organize these preferences to deliver targeted and relevant emails to customers.
With the rise of smartphones, SMS and mobile-based communications have become an essential channel for customer interaction. SMS and mobile preferences refer to whether a customer prefers to receive updates or notifications via text message, mobile apps, or push notifications. BPO services help businesses track and manage these preferences, ensuring efficient and timely communication.
Many customers prefer live chat for its convenience and speed, especially when seeking customer support. Live chat preferences refer to whether a customer prefers to communicate through chatbots, live agents, or other real-time messaging services. BPOs manage these preferences to provide customers with instant support through their preferred medium.
Social media platforms have become one of the most popular channels for customer engagement. Social media preferences involve the customer’s choice of platforms for receiving updates, interacting with brands, or seeking support (e.g., Facebook, Twitter, Instagram). BPO providers track these preferences and ensure businesses can engage with customers across the appropriate social media channels.
Many customers prefer to handle issues independently via self-service portals or FAQs. Self-service preferences refer to whether a customer prefers to resolve their queries through automated systems, knowledge bases, or self-help tools. BPO providers support businesses in managing these preferences to improve the customer experience.
Mobile applications have become a preferred channel for many customers. App preferences involve the customer’s desire to interact with a brand or service through its mobile app. This can include receiving push notifications, interacting with in-app customer support, or managing their account via the app. BPOs help businesses ensure that their app-based communications align with customer preferences.
As video communication tools become more prevalent, many customers now prefer video support for more complex issues or personalized services. Video support preferences refer to customers’ willingness to engage with a business through video calls, webinars, or video conferencing platforms. BPOs manage these preferences to offer an enhanced level of customer interaction.
Effective Channel Preferences Support in BPO brings numerous advantages to both businesses and customers. Some key benefits include:
By aligning communication methods with customer preferences, businesses create a more personalized and positive customer experience. Customers are more likely to engage with companies that reach them via their preferred channels, whether through voice, email, chat, or social media.
When businesses communicate with customers on their preferred channels, it fosters trust and satisfaction, which are crucial for customer retention. By respecting customer preferences, BPO providers can help businesses build long-term relationships and minimize churn rates.
Offering communication through preferred channels enhances customer engagement. Whether customers prefer receiving information via email, SMS, or social media, businesses can increase the likelihood of customer interaction by accommodating these preferences.
Managing and optimizing channel preferences enables businesses to focus their resources on the most effective channels for customer communication. BPO providers help businesses allocate resources effectively by identifying the channels that yield the highest return on investment (ROI).
Certain industries must adhere to strict regulations related to customer communication, especially regarding marketing and consent. By managing channel preferences, businesses can ensure they comply with data privacy laws like GDPR and CCPA, reducing the risk of legal issues.
Channel preferences often reflect the customer’s desired response time. By allowing customers to communicate through their preferred channels (e.g., live chat for instant responses), BPO providers can help businesses resolve customer queries more efficiently, enhancing overall satisfaction.
Tracking customer channel preferences allows businesses to collect valuable data on customer behavior. BPOs can leverage this data to generate insights that inform marketing strategies, customer support processes, and product development.
To ensure businesses make the most of Channel Preferences Support in BPO, it’s essential to follow best practices. Here are some optimization strategies:
It’s essential for BPO providers to integrate customer preferences across all communication channels. This ensures that customers can switch from one channel to another (e.g., from email to live chat) without losing continuity in the conversation.
Businesses should offer support across multiple channels to accommodate various customer preferences. BPO providers should have the capability to manage multi-channel interactions seamlessly, allowing customers to reach businesses through their preferred platform.
AI-powered tools, such as chatbots, can help optimize Channel Preferences Support in BPO. These tools can automate the process of capturing customer preferences and offering timely, personalized communication. Automation also helps businesses scale their operations efficiently.
Some customers prefer self-service options. BPO providers can help businesses develop and maintain knowledge bases, FAQs, and self-service portals that allow customers to resolve issues independently, according to their preferred channels.
Customer preferences can change over time. Regularly monitoring and updating channel preferences ensures that businesses are always communicating with customers in the most effective way. BPO providers should continuously track changes in preferences to ensure accuracy.
